Comprehensive Breakdown of Engine Parts
Engine BlockThe engine block is the heart of the Dodge Ram, forming the structure that houses the cylinders, pistons, and other crucial elements. Made from cast iron or aluminum, the block needs to sustain extreme heat and pressure throughout operation. Routine examination for cracks or use can avoid pricey repair work.
PistonsPistons go up and down within the cylinders, driven by the combustion of fuel. They play a substantial function in creating power and needs to be robust to hold up against severe conditions. Indications of piston wear can consist of oil intake or loss of power.
CrankshaftThe crankshaft transforms the direct motion of the pistons into rotational motion. It needs to be balanced exactly to guarantee smooth engine operation. Vibration or knocking sounds can signify a stopping working crankshaft.
CamshaftThe camshaft manages the opening and closing of the engine valves. In modern-day Dodge Rams, this part is typically variable to optimize engine efficiency and fuel performance.
Timing Belt/ChainThis element integrates the crankshaft and camshaft, making sure that the engine's valves open and close at the appropriate times throughout each cylinder's intake and exhaust strokes. Frequently checking the timing belt for wear can avoid engine failure.
Oil PumpThe oil pump is essential for keeping lubrication throughout the engine, ensuring that all moving parts get adequate oil supply. A stopping working oil pump can lead to devastating engine damage.
Fuel InjectorsFuel injectors provide the exact quantity of fuel into the combustion chamber. A clogged injector can trigger engine misfires and minimized performance.
Ignition SystemThis system consists of stimulate plugs and coils that fire up the fuel-air mix. Regular upkeep of these components can boost fuel economy and efficiency.
Exhaust ManifoldThe exhaust manifold collects exhaust gases from the engine cylinders and directs them to the exhaust system. Any leaks can considerably impact engine performance and emissions.
Maintenance Tips for Dodge Ram Engine Parts
Reliable upkeep is crucial for making sure the longevity and dependability of Dodge Ram engine parts. Here are some essential upkeep suggestions:
Maintenance Checklist
Regular Oil Changes
- Change oil every 5,000-7,500 miles.
- Use manufacturer-recommended oil type.
Examination of Belts and Chains
- Look for wear and stress every 10,000 miles.
- Replace timing belts according to the service handbook.
Keeping Track Of Fluid Levels
- Check coolant, oil, and transmission fluid levels regularly.
Air Filter Replacement
- Change air filters every 15,000-30,000 miles to make sure optimum airflow to the engine.
Fuel System Cleaning
- Carry out a fuel system cleansing every 30,000 miles to prevent injector clogging.
Trigger Plug Inspection
- Replace spark plugs every 30,000-100,000 miles depending on the type utilized.
When to Replace Engine Parts
Understanding when to replace engine elements can save time and cash. Here are some indications that indicate it's time for a replacement:
Signs for Replacement
- Oil Leaks: Persistent leakages can indicate a stopping working gasket or oil pump.
- Unusual Noises: Knocking or grinding noises might show issues with the crankshaft or pistons.
- Poor Performance: Decreased power or acceleration might connect to malfunctioning injectors, stimulate plugs, or air filters.
- Engine Overheating: This can signify a stopping working oil pump or coolant system problems.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How often should I change my Dodge Ram's oil?
It is normally suggested to alter the oil every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, depending upon your driving conditions and the oil type used.
2. What type of fuel should I utilize in my Dodge Ram?
A lot of Dodge Ram models run efficiently on routine unleaded fuel. However, specific high-performance designs might recommend premium fuel for optimum performance.
3. How can I enhance my Dodge Ram's fuel effectiveness?
Routine maintenance, including timely oil changes, air filter replacements, and proper tire pressure checks, can significantly enhance fuel performance.
4. Is it essential to utilize OEM parts for replacements?
While OEM parts often offer the very best fit and dependability, Aftermarket Dodge Ram Accessories parts can be utilized if they fulfill quality requirements. Guarantee they're suitable with your specific model.
5. Can I perform engine maintenance myself?
Basic maintenance jobs like altering oil, filters, and stimulate plugs can often be carried out in the house. However, more complicated repairs must be left to professionals.
